ipyrad: interactive assembly and analysis of RADseq data sets
=============================================================
Welcome to ipyrad, an interactive toolkit for assembly and analysis of
restriction-site associated genomic data sets (e.g., RAD, ddRAD, GBS) for
population genetic and phylogenetic studies.
